Transaction 311786a9707b1a82fcf5b46c1dcd01ea3a3e947c8a7d683e2eb44caedafe7090

block
23f7b42c07cd0ca9a50b72913f9303a5c771a38f2edc37b93f02565d0fe558a6

1 Input

2 Outputs